Issue with the current 24.03 build that came out today. This is showing on the login page after install and subsequent reboots:
"Parse error: Unclosed '{' on line 454 in /usr/local/www/guiconfig.inc on line 1239"
Also, the past few updates show "Unknown firmware" on my 6100 MAX.

@behemyth It's just seems to be the GUI that's broken. You can always connect to your 6100 base via console cable and change back to the previous boot environment during the boot sequence. I wish there was a way to do this via SSH, so this will have to wait for me.
